Tajeyar Camp Population - East Kameng, Arunachal Pradesh

Tajeyar Camp is a small village located in Bameng Circle of East Kameng district, Arunachal Pradesh with total 21 families residing. The Tajeyar Camp village has population of 83 of which 37 are males while 46 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Tajeyar Camp village population of children with age 0-6 is 12 which makes up 14.46 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Tajeyar Camp village is 1243 which is higher than Arunachal Pradesh state average of 938. Child Sex Ratio for the Tajeyar Camp as per census is 3000, higher than Arunachal Pradesh average of 972.

Tajeyar Camp village has lower literacy rate compared to Arunachal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Tajeyar Camp village was 29.58 % compared to 65.38 % of Arunachal Pradesh. In Tajeyar Camp Male literacy stands at 47.06 % while female literacy rate was 13.51 %.
